The basic aspect and practice of a second phase design of ductile frames has been studied by an example in the tentative design of an industrial building. The building is situated in Tanggu District of Tianjin City and it is a seven-story industrial frame with non-uniformly distributed strength and rigidity in the vertical direction. To meet the requirements against moderate and strong earthquakes on deformation and strength respectively, it is estimated the building would sustain slight damage under moderate earthquake and would not collapse under strong seismic motion if grid-type stirrups for columns were used as an alternative to traditional stirrup arrangements.
